Output e189b0415d8e6c2bd79c1a68be43b2f4d5cdba12a5b6da4f12561c241b61fda9:2

value
129129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a516491b5a3120ff26a609c1572484a307c7b53 OP_EQUAL
address
3QWaMmwPeUHmqgS8UemjvQRaUfDAPQkBjZ
transaction
e189b0415d8e6c2bd79c1a68be43b2f4d5cdba12a5b6da4f12561c241b61fda9
spent
true